Ahsaas Channa to play an ace gamer in Clutch  

CE Features

Dice Media recently announced Clutch, India’s first web-series based on esports. The platform has roped in Ahsaas Channa (Kota Factory) to play an ace gamer on the show. 

In Clutch, the primary characters will be seen competing in a major esports tournament. The show traces the journey of an underdog esports team. 

"Having been a part of popular movies and series like Kota Factory and My Friend Ganesha, Ahsaas has made a mark for herself in the entertainment industry," read a note from the creators. "She has been immensely loved for her many talents, and one may not be surprised that it was her love for gaming that helped her bag the role in this all-new series. Being an avid gamer, she has not only participated in various esports tournaments but is seen actively promoting various tournaments on her social media." 

Dice Media has created shows like Operation MBBS, What The Folks, Adulting, Please Find Attached and Firsts. They are also the original producers of Little Things (on Netflix).
